Ranchi News: In a shocking incident, a 47-year-old restaurant owner in Ranchi was shot dead after allegedly serving non-vegetarian biryani to a customer who had ordered vegetarian food, police said on Sunday.

An investigation is underway, and the body has been sent to Rajendra Institute of Medical Sciences (RIMS) for a post-mortem examination. Police are carrying out raids at several locations to arrest the suspects, news agency PTI quoted a police official as saying.

Dispute Over Biryani Leads To Fatal Incident In Ranchi

The fatal incident unfolded around 11:30 AM on Saturday at a hotel on Kanke-Pithoria Road, when a customer who had initially ordered vegetarian biryani left with his parcel but soon returned with a group, accusing the restaurant of serving non-vegetarian biryani instead, said Superintendent of Police (Rural) Praveen Pushkar.

When the customer arrived with a group, the 47-year-old restaurant owner, identified as Vijay Kumar Nag, was having food inside the restaurant. One of the assailants fired a shot, hitting him in the chest.

Soon after the incident, Nag was rushed to the hospital, where he succumbed to his injuries. The deceased, Vijay Kumar Nag, was a resident of Bhittha under the Kanke police station limits.

His body has been sent to Rajendra Institute of Medical Sciences (RIMS) for a post-mortem. Police are conducting raids at multiple locations in an effort to trace and arrest the assailants, the police further said. Further investigation is underway to determine whether there was any additional motive behind the incident.

Kanke police station officer-in-charge Prakash Rajak said, “Irate locals on Sunday morning blocked the Kanke-Pithoria Road for some time, demanding action against the culprits. The blockade was later lifted after we assured them that the assailants would be arrested soon.”
